Fujitsu boosts Asian market
TOKYO (AFP): Japanese computer giant Fujitsu Ltd. plans to
team up with Oracle Corp. of the United States to sell and
install computer systems running Oracle's database software in
Asia, a spokesman said yesterday.
The agreement was reached by Fujitsu and Oracle Systems S.E.
Asia Pacific Ltd., a regional unit of the US software company,
the Fujitsu spokesman said.
Under the plan, Fujitsu will install Oracle programming on its
high-performance small servers for sales in the region, while
Oracle will provide technical support for Fujitsu subsidiaries,
the spokesman said.
The accord covers 12 Asian countries and regions -- Australia,
China, Hong Kong, Indonesia, Malaysia, New Zealand, the
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, Thailand, Taiwan and
Vietnam, the spokesman said.
The computer technology firms are targeting orders for 1,500-
2,000 systems from the end of the year to March 2001.
